Robert J. McDonald of Branford died Sunday August 6, 2017 at Connecticut Hospice in Branford. He was the beloved husband of 63 years to Ann Etzel McDonald. He was born in New Haven on July 27, 1927, son of the late Joseph and Anna Kane McDonald.
He was a U. S. Army veteran of World War II. He worked as a switchboard operator for the UI Company for many years until retiring. Besides his wife, he is survived by his children, Dennis (Elizabeth) McDonald, Mary McDonald, Martin McDonald and Eileen McDonald (close friend Jerry Ganzle); his grandchildren, Ian and David McDonald; and many nieces, nephews, and cousins.

He was predeceased by his seven siblings, Margaret Soule, Harriet Clausen, Joseph McDonald, Anna Shappy, Agnes Moore, Jimmy McDonald, and Frances Navrotsky.Relatives and friends are invited to a Mass of Christian Burial Wednesday at 10:00 AM in St. Mary Church, Branford. Burial will be private. THERE ARE NO CALLING HOURS.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to the charity of your choice.
